Coatimundis, or coatamundis, are omnivorous mammals that primarily eat fruits, insects, small vertebrates, and eggs. They are known for their foraging behavior, often using their long snouts to dig into the ground or bark for food. In addition to fruits and insects, they may also consume small animals like rodents or birds when the opportunity arises. Their diverse diet helps them thrive in various habitats, from tropical forests to savannas.
